Kelly, Blumenauer introduce legislation to aid railroad projects

On Wednesday, U.S. Rep. Mike Kelly, R-16th, in his capacity as chairman of the Ways & Means Subcommittee on Tax, introduced the Short Line Railroad Tax Credit Modernization Act in partnership with U.S. Rep. Earl Blumenauer, D-Or.

The proposed legislation would make permanent the Railroad Track Maintenance Tax Credit, a federal income tax credit for regional shortline railroads that went into effect in January 2005. Initially set to expire at the end of 2009, it was repeatedly extended before expiring at the end of 2017.

The tax credit would enable regional and shortline railroads to claim a 50-cent tax credit for each dollar spent on rehabilitation and maintenance projects, which would encourage such projects.

The two previously introduced similar legislation in 2019.
